Output db26305b9071a83bc905d4a7c4143acbb7a5fb52b6c68bde51299fd821de8a08:2

value
621050
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af43f32d49fcdb5912843f365c0d67df504894cf OP_EQUAL
address
3HfjaMdnbHZvyjZqhiY6pH5xrPDaAZqaYR
transaction
db26305b9071a83bc905d4a7c4143acbb7a5fb52b6c68bde51299fd821de8a08
spent
true